>500 euro
We open our storage room and take out one of the most popular entry-level speakers of the moment. The Q Acoustics 3030i , our reference in this price range mainly because it does so much right. We also tested the 3050i floorstander but found it too tame with many amps. The 3030i is more balanced and is not a difficult partner. In addition, it has surprisingly good bass and is tweeter does not make the ears bleed but there is still plenty of detail. It is obviously not perfect but a fine all-rounder
Alternatives include the previously mentioned Elac Debut, Acoustic Energy AE101, Monitor Audio Bronze, Dali Obéron, Dynaudio Emit, Kef Q150, Wharfedale 12.1, Dali Spektor,…
500-1000 euro
Here we cannot ignore the Bowers and Wilkins 606S2 (Dutch review). We have them in house permanently and get them out regularly when we feel like partying. They sound great and look great. An anniversary edition came out recently but we think the regular version is very good and definitely reference material.
This speaker initially surprises with its enormously powerful bass but also the mid and high end is fine and never disturbs. The 606S2 is nicely balanced and with all with an affordable amplifier will perform very well.
Alternatives include the Monitor Audio Silver 100, Kef Q350, Sonus Faber Lamina1,…
1000-1500 euro
in this popular price range, we have no less than two references that we often refer back to. The first is the Elac Carina BS 243.3 which possesses a delightful Jet tweeter. The mid-driver produces tight and punchy bass, helped by the ‘down-firing’ port. The Carina is soft in the highs, lets a lot of detail through but has a rather laid back sound that can make you listen to it for hours
A second, less obvious candidate is the Vienna Acoustics Haydn Jubilee. We love it and find its coherence and tonality particularly addictive. In our opinion, this speaker never lets you down. What a wonderful speaker to fall back on. The Haydn Jubilee is a Limited Edition (35/500) but for those who can’t get their hands on any more, there is still the regular Haydn. Ours, at least, is not going away anymore.
Alternatives are the Acoustic Energy AE500, Sonus Faber Sonetto 1, Definitive Technology Demand11, Golden Ear Reference BRX, Dali Menuet SE,…
